Curator/Researcher
Yasushi Mori (Ph.D)
Petrologist
Education
-
- B.S., Department of Geology, Kyushu University (1994)
- M.S., Department of Earth and Planetary Sciences, Kyushu University, (1996)
- Ph.D., Department of Earth and Planetary Sciences, Kyushu University, (1999)
Research interests
- Metamorphic petrology, Subduction zone, Fluid flow, Mass transfer, Metasomatism, Jadeitite, Ultramafic melange, Nagasaki metamorphic rocks (Kyushu, Japan)
Current research focuses
-
- Fluid flow, mass transfer and metasomatism in serpentinite melanges
- Petrogenesis of jadeitite and related rocks
- Geology and petrology of the Nagasaki metamorphic rocks
